Revisiting older imports, i found out this one is not listed on here.
It may not be the best looking cd (at the time Memory was VERY basic), the show itself may not be the best ever by Elvis(many false starts for example and he sound pretty tired), still, it's a cd that is very welcome.
The show has turned up several times before in the cdr circuit, but for this pressed one the label gives us a high quality audience source.
Elvis can be heard very clearly, the sound is very good, there is almost no typical "Vegas-echo".
I liked the versions of "America, the beautiful"(the last ever version) and "Hawaiian wedding song" very much.
The absolute highlight is "Help me", sung with pure emotion.
A fine sounding show, a very decent performance.
